-resourceText = r'''<?xml version="1.0"?>
-<resource>
-
-<!-- Notice that the class IS a standard wx class, and a custom
- subclass is specified as "moduleName.ClassName" Try changing
- the classname to one that does not exist and see what happens -->
-
-<object class="wxPanel" subclass="wxXmlResourceSubclass.MyBluePanel" name="MyPanel">
- <size>200,100</size>
- <object class="wxStaticText" name="label1">
- <label>This blue panel is a class derived from wxPanel
-and is loaded by a using a subclass attribute of the object tag.</label>
- <pos>10,10</pos>
- </object>
-</object>
-</resource>
-'''
-
-#----------------------------------------------------------------------
-
-class MyBluePanel(wx.Panel):
- def __init__(self):
- p = wx.PrePanel()
- self.PostCreate(p)
-
- self.Bind(wx.EVT_WINDOW_CREATE, self.OnCreate)
-
- def OnCreate(self, evt):
- # This is the little bit of customization that we do for this
- # silly example. It could just as easily have been done in
- # the resource. We do it in the EVT_WINDOW_CREATE handler
- # because the window doesn't really exist yet in the __init__.
- self.SetBackgroundColour("BLUE")
- self.SetForegroundColour("WHITE")
-
